Area contextNeighborhood Overview – New Paltz High School (New Paltz, NY)
New Paltz High School is strategically situated in the charming town of New Paltz, New York, known for its stunning natural beauty and vibrant community spirit. The school is located off South Putt Corners Road, a main artery connecting local residents and visitors to surrounding areas. Access to the school is straightforward, with ample parking available on campus. For those flying in, the closest major airport is Stewart International Airport (SWF), located approximately a 30-minute drive south. Albany International Airport (ALB) is a longer option, about an hour and 15 minutes to an hour and a half drive north. Public transportation options are limited in this more rural setting; however, rideshare services and taxis are generally available for transport from nearby towns or transportation hubs. Plan your arrival for weekday events at least 30-45 minutes before game time to account for potential traffic on local roads, especially during peak commuting hours or popular event days. Weekend events may have less congestion, but it's always wise to check local advisories or school announcements.

Downtown New Paltz (Main Street)
A short drive or a brisk walk from the high school leads you to the heart of New Paltz: its vibrant Main Street. This bustling avenue is lined with a diverse array of shops, from unique boutiques and artisan craft stores to bookstores and outdoor gear outfitters. It’s a lively area perfect for browsing, grabbing a coffee, or enjoying a casual meal. The street also hosts various community events and farmers' markets throughout the year, adding to its dynamic atmosphere. For visitors, Main Street offers a taste of local culture and a pleasant place to unwind after an athletic event.
Main Street · 1.5 miSUNY New Paltz Campus
The State University of New York at New Paltz campus is a significant cultural and recreational resource located just minutes from the high school. Beyond its academic buildings, the campus features open green spaces, the Samuel Dorsky Museum of Art, and the Samuel Jones Performing Arts Center, which occasionally hosts public performances. Visitors can enjoy a walk through the well-maintained grounds, explore the student union, or visit the museum for a dose of art and culture. The university's presence also contributes to a youthful and energetic vibe in the town, with various events and facilities open to the public at different times.
1 Hawk Drive · 1.8 miBeyond the Event: The surrounding Ulster County region boasts numerous state parks, historic sites, and wineries, offering further exploration opportunities for those with extra time. Consider visiting nearby historic Huguenot Street or venturing out to explore the iconic Mohonk Mountain House for breathtaking views. The scenic beauty of the Hudson Valley provides a perfect backdrop for any visit, whether for a short sporting event or a longer stay.

The Gilded Otter
The Gilded Otter is a popular gastropub located on Main Street, known for its creative menu, extensive craft beer list, and lively ambiance. They offer a range of dishes from hearty entrees to lighter fare, making it suitable for various tastes. It's a great spot for a post-game meal where adults can enjoy a good selection of drinks and food in a relaxed, upscale-casual setting. The outdoor patio is a particular draw during the warmer months, offering a pleasant dining experience with views of the town.
Main Street · 1.5 miA Tavola Trattoria
For those seeking authentic Italian cuisine, A Tavola Trattoria on Main Street provides a refined dining experience. Specializing in handmade pasta and traditional Italian dishes, it offers a slightly more upscale option for families or groups looking for a memorable meal. The intimate setting and quality of food make it an excellent choice for celebrating a victory or enjoying a special occasion. Reservations are often recommended, especially on weekends, to secure a table.

Weather & Seasons at New Paltz High School
- Winter: Winter in New Paltz can be cold, with average temperatures ranging from the low 20s to high 30s Fahrenheit. Visitors should pack warm layers, including he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ear, as snow is common. Outdoor events may require extra blankets, and indoor activities or venues with good heating are highly sought after. Travel times may be slightly extended due to potential road conditions after snowfall.
- Spring & early summer: Spring brings milder temperatures, with highs typically in the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it, gradually warming into the 70s by early summer. This season is characterized by frequent rain showers, so packing a waterproof jacket and umbrella is advisable. It's a comfortable time for outdoor events, though evenings can still be cool, suggesting light layers or a jacket. The landscape becomes lush and green, enhancing the scenic beauty of the area.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from July to August, is generally warm to hot, with average temperatures in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, occasionally reaching into the 90s. Humidity can make it feel warmer, so light, breathable clothing is recommended. Staying hydrated is crucial, especially for athletes and spectators at outdoor events. Sunscreen and hats are essential for protection during daytime activities, and portable fans can provide welcome relief.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p, cool air with daytime temperatures typically in the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it, perfect for outdoor activities and enjoying the vibrant foliage. Evenings can become chilly, so packing layers, including sweaters or light jackets, is recommended. While generally dry, occasional rain is possible. This season is popular for visitors due to the scenic beauty, so booking accommodations in advance is wise.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ible in any season, but more frequent in spring and fall. Snowfall is typical during winter months, potentially impacting travel and outdoor event schedules. Visitors should always check local weather forecasts and road conditions before traveling, especially during winter. Having a flexible mindset and backup indoor activity plans is always a good idea when traveling to regions with variable weather patterns.
